<p>Here&#8217;s the question:</p>
<p>Hi Tim,<br />
I&#8217;m looking for the best way to market directly to &quot;Internet Marketers&quot;. We have a program involving strategies to help self-employed business owners reduce their taxes, especially their 15.3% self-employment tax. Since most Internet Marketers are self-employed, their taxes are about to go up next year and this program will dramatically increase their bottom line. However, we have never done online marketing and are total novices in this area. Any idea how we can quickly penetrate this market?</p>
<p>-Ron</p>
<p>Ron, off the top of my head I can think of a GREAT strategy for you.  It requires just a few things:</p>
<p>1. A professional website.<br />
2. A clear demonstration of how much they can save in relation to how much they are paying you for your services.</p>
<p>For instance, if you know the approximate percentage that you can help business owners to save on their taxes given their predicted income, then have a programmer create the code so that you can put something that looks like this on your website:</p>
<h5><img src="http://www.tribaltim.com/images/savingscalculator.jpg" alt="savingscalc" /></h5>
<p>Whenever people can interact with your website, and you can demonstrate just how much your product is REALLY worth to them, it makes it almost impossible to not buy it!</p>
<p>Now, in order to market to internet marketers&#8230;Think about how you can contact them directly, if they aren&#8217;t already searching for your product:</p>
<p>By email!  Every internet marketer has either a customer service system or their very own email address on their website.  Some even have a phone number (which might be better in your case).</p>
<p>Contact them to let them know about the product you&#8217;ve created and the average percentage that you will save them on their taxes.</p>
<p>If you told me you were going to save me over $10,000, and you were going to charge me less than $1,000 to do it, I&#8217;d likely say yes (as long as you seem like a trustworthy fellow!)</p>
<p>Thanks for the question Ron.</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s the lesson:</p>
<p>How you can get people to interact with your product to demonstrate its value BEFORE they buy?  Free trials, beta versions, savings calculators, and FREE information-packed reports, ebooks, or videos are all popular options.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Dear Entrepreneur,</p>
<p>The biggest MVA (most valuable asset) mistake is not knowing what your MVA is&#8230;</p>
<p>You&#8217;ve started getting people interested in you and your product/service…You&#8217;ve even collected a bunch of email addresses.  Now what?</p>
<p>There are a lot of opinions on what should happen next.  A lot of people force their new subscribers/prospects into an unfortunate series of auto-responders.  Don&#8217;t get me wrong, auto-responders can be GREAT time savers and can bring in a lot of new revenue.  They can also make your new prospect dislike you.</p>
<p><img src="http://tribaltim.com/images/relationships.jpg" alt="relationships" /></p>
<p>You have to realize that getting prospects to give you their email addresses is only a fraction of the battle.  The most important thing for you to focus on is what happens AFTER they give you their email addresses…Because <strong>Your Most Valuable Asset is your Relationship With Your Prospects/Customers.</strong></p>
<p>In order to tell you what should happen after you get their email addresses, let’s start with what NOT to do:</p>
<p>First and foremost, do not start slamming affiliate promotions down the throats of your new prospects before building a relationship with them.  If you do this, your prospects will regret signing up to receive emails from you, and are far more likely to unsubscribe.</p>
<p>Second, DON&#8217;T overdo it by sending way too many emails!  People will get annoyed if you fire off too many emails at them!</p>
<p><img src="http://tribaltim.com/images/bad_inbox.jpg" alt="bad inbox" /></p>
<p>You REALLY should work on your relationship with your prospects before recommending products for them to buy (including your own).</p>
<p>Focusing on your relationship with your prospects is one of the best things you can do to increase your success.  If you build a relationship with someone and they like you and what you give them for free, then it is far more likely that they will purchase from you when you do try to sell them a product.</p>
<p>And by nurturing your pre-sale relationship , your post-sale relationship building process will be a piece of cake.  Customers who buy products they like from people they like are more likely to continue buying from the same seller, GUARANTEED.</p>
<p>This concept makes a lot of sense, but is OFTEN overlooked.  Allow me to lay it out for you in the simplest of terms:</p>
<p>Give people something really cool in exchange for their email addresses.  Then give them more cool stuff for free, causing them to like you.  Then sell them ultra cool stuff they&#8217;ll like a lot.  Continue to make them like you even more.  Then sell them more ultra cool stuff, make more money, and be able to afford to go to Starbucks 3 times a day&#8230;etc.</p>
<p>Prospects and Customers that REALLY like you are more likely to:<br />
-Buy More Stuff<br />
-Refer and Promote Your Products to Their Friends<br />
-Give Great Reviews/Testimonials<br />
-Not Return Products<br />
-Be Happy</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>One of the most important pieces of information that you will ever collect from anyone who is interested in you, your product/service, or your niche, is their email address.  The reason that email address is SO important to you is because it allows you to communicate with them without them having to visit your website.  Without their email addresses, you will have to hope that you make one heck of a first impression…one so great that they’ll come back on their own, without a pressing reason.</p>
<p>There is only one asset that is more valuable than obtaining prospects&#8217; email addresses for your list, but you NEED a list in order to attain it…</p>
<p><em>(Stay tuned for your #1 asset next week)</em></p>
<p>When it comes to getting your prospects to give you their emailaddresses, you&#8217;ll need a couple of KEY ingredients:</p>
<p><strong>1.</strong> Customer Resource Management (CRM) System - Like Infusionsoft, Aweber, ConstantContact, iContact, etc.</p>
<p>Your CRM System will be the platform through which you send all of your email communications to your prospects (most CRM providers have A LOT more features than just sending broadcast emails!)</p>
<p><strong>2.</strong> Opt-in Form - Whether it&#8217;s on your blog, website, or a squeeze page, you need an opt-in form that prospects can fill out and submit.</p>
<p><strong>3.</strong> Compelling Reason to Opt In - Lets face facts - you have to give to get. No one is just going to give you their email address without receiving anything in return.  Make sure that whatever you give the prospects when they opt in is so phenomenal that they CAN&#8217;T WAIT to see what else you have to offer.</p>
<p>If what you&#8217;re giving away doesn&#8217;t blow their minds, then why would people choose to buy from you?  Think about it…why do the Asian restaurants in the food court at the mall always give out a sample of tasty chicken or steak on a stick?  The answer is simple: they&#8217;re banking on you liking your free sample so much that you&#8217;ll come in and purchase the whole meal.  This is EXACTLY what internet marketers do whenever they launch a new product.  They give you a little to get you to buy A LOT.</p>
<p>During launch week for the Tribal Formula, my Entrepreneur List grew from 5,000 to 20,000.  How?  Here&#8217;s a link to the squeeze page - <a href="http://www.tribalformula.com" target="_blank">TribalFormula.com</a> - (Please note, the yellow box did not exist during launch week).</p>
<p>I gave prospects something EXTREMELY VALUABLE in exchange for their email addresses.</p>

<p>THIS is the truth…there&#8217;s NO SUCH THING as an Easy Button.</p>
<p>You are not going to start a business today and make $50,000 tomorrow.  It just does not work like that.</p>
<p><strong>The true keys to any great entrepreneur&#8217;s success are:</strong> (in no particular order)</p>
<p>1. <strong>Hard Work:</strong> This seems too obvious to even be on the list, but some people think they can get by without it.  Hard work goes a LONG way.  Diligently working hard to meet goals and get the project done is #1 on my &quot;keys to success&quot; list for a reason - even if these are in no particular order ;).</p>
<p>2. <strong>Smart Work:</strong> If you aren&#8217;t working smart, you&#8217;re wasting your time.  Focus on doing the things that you are best at, and outsource or hire someone to do the things that you shouldn&#8217;t be focusing your time on.</p>
<p>3. <strong>Productivity:</strong> Productivity is more or less a combination of hard work and smart work.  Always be on the look for tools and resources to increase your productivity…Increasing the ROI (return on investment) of your TIME depends upon it.</p>
<p>4. <strong>Education</strong> : $1.3 Million…That&#8217;s roughly the amount of money that I have spent on my personal marketing education.  You don&#8217;t need to spend that kind of money to be a successful entrepreneur, but you do need to educate yourself to increase the success of your business.  Are you an expert in your niche?  Are you the best copywriter around?  Can you quickly and easily make a great webpage?  There&#8217;s always something more that you can learn - whether regarding your niche or how to market and sell your products.</p>
<p>5. <strong>Value:</strong> No matter what you are providing, whether its a product or service, the best thing you can do to ensure success is to provide a SERIOUS amount of value…By that I mean if the customer pays $10 for your product or service, they should feel like it is worth <em>at least</em> $100.  You can&#8217;t fake real value.  Customers will appreciate you and come back to you if they find value in your product.</p>
<p>6.<strong> Love what you do:</strong> If you don&#8217;t LOVE talking about your niche and the products or services you sell, then why do it at all?  If you&#8217;re just in it for pay day, then you are only basing your success on money.  I&#8217;d rather make $100,000 a year doing something I LOVE than $1,000,000 a year doing something I DESPISE.</p>
<p>7. <strong>Action:</strong> Simply put, <em>don&#8217;t sit back</em> .  Do you have an idea?  Create criteria for it, Brainstorm options, Select what&#8217;s most important to you, and Implement it…. NOW!</p>
